1. Jensen Huang: The Visionary Behind NVIDIA
Jensen Huang, co-founder and CEO of NVIDIA, has been at the helm since 1993. Born in Taiwan and raised in America, Huang’s journey from a small-town kid to a tech titan is nothing short of inspiring. His leadership has transformed NVIDIA into a powerhouse in graphics processing units (GPUs) and artificial intelligence (AI). Under his guidance, NVIDIA has become synonymous with technological innovation, setting new standards in computing technology. 🚀💡
